Roses Decorate This Nike Giannis Immortality

Roses Decorate This Nike Giannis Immortality

Ahead of Valentine’s Day 2022, NIKE, Inc. has unveiled several of its most popular designs in February 14th-friendly colorways. The Nike Giannis Immortality – the “Greek Freak”‘s budget-oriented offering – has recently joined the conversation via a white, red and pink colorway complete with rose details on the medial side.

While predecessors like the Zoom Freak 1 featured the aforementioned flower to commemorate Giannis Antetokounmpo‘s late-father, the embellishment’s inclusion on the Milwaukee Bucks forward’s next sneaker likely draws from the mid-February holiday and not the 27-year-old’s father Charles. “Colorless” textile sets the stage for handfuls of scarlet and pink hits across the upper. And though the embroidered flower on the medial profile delivers a special makeover of the hoops-ready pair, the red that animates the sole unit also demand some attention.

Enjoy official images of the sneakers here below, and anticipate a Nike.com launch in the coming weeks.
